Powerful Influences: A Case of One Student Teacher Renegotiating His Perceptions of Power Relations.
Graham, Peg
Teaching and Teacher Education, v15 n5 p523-40 Jul 1999
Investigated the power relationship between cooperating and student teachers. Data from student journals, classroom observations, field-experience artifacts, seminars, and informal conversations indicated that the power relationship was productive for participants. Results highlight the importance of prehistories and personal narratives in constructing the shared-power relationship and of mentor and student-teacher tensions as a site for mutual learning. (SM)
